How they compare
Lebanon currently reports 181,392 against 164,177 in Sri Lanka, a difference of 17,215.
That makes Lebanon's figure about 1.1 times Sri Lanka's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Sri Lanka ahead.
Lebanon ranks 112th and Sri Lanka ranks 113th of 196 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Lebanon averaged higher in 3 and Sri Lanka in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lebanon | Sri Lanka |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 119,111 | 207,435 | 88,324 | Sri Lanka |
| 1970s | 64,500 | 225,566 | 161,066 | Sri Lanka |
| 1980s | 113,596 | 182,439 | 68,843 | Sri Lanka |
| 1990s | 164,020 | 181,066 | 17,046 | Sri Lanka |
| 2000s | 256,576 | 196,184 | 60,392 | Lebanon |
| 2010s | 227,670 | 166,584 | 61,086 | Lebanon |
| 2020s | 202,501 | 154,480 | 48,021 | Lebanon |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
